University Profile
Shenyang Aerospace University (SAU) is located in the university city in Shenbei New District, a major development district of China. Since its founding in 1952, it has been one of the major aeronautical universities in China. As early as 1958, the students and teachers manufactured their own plane.
The university has developed into an academic centrer, housing teaching buildings, research laboratories, a library which is both an architectural and cultural icon, a theatre building, sports arena, swimming centre and student’s activity centers having 600,000 square meters of floor space on 1 and pver 200, 000 square meters of landscaped gardens. Other services such as the school hospital, comfortable accommodations and a number of dining halls are also provided.
The university has 1,600 staff, 900 of which are academic, and boasts an attendance of more than 20,000 students. While focusing on engineering disciplines, SAU’s scope has been enhanced with curricula covering such areas as science, management and liberal arts. The university has 44 disciplines for undergraduate study, 50 disciplines for master degrees, and joint programs for PhDs. SAU degrees are recognized around the world.
SAU prides itself on its practical teaching system which includes basic, professional and general practice. There are numerous first-rate labs for the students, some at national level.
SAU is also proud of its Aircraft Maintenance Center, which is the only one in China approved by the China Civil Aviation Authority to issue licenses to maintain helicopters. Authorization of fixed-wing aircraft maintenance licenses is anticipated soon. There are 20 aircrafts provided for the students to practice with on the campus.
SAU has established cooperation with many companies and institutes including the Shenyang Liming Aero-engine Group Corporation, the Avic Shenyang Aircraft Corporation, and has developed a network of 50 partnerships to provide practical training opportunities both inside and outside the campus.
During its 60 years, about 50,000 students have graduated from the university, with numerous students achieving high honors. SAU graduates historically have had a very high employment rate with around 90% being employed soon after graduation.
Internationalization is one of the characteristics of SAU. The university has established cooperative agreements with more than 80 universities and companies from around the world. It has an active exchange program for both teachers and students.
The university employs a number of foreign teachers who contribute to both the academic and cultural life of the school community. At present, there are over 380 international students studying Aircraft Manufacture, Aerospace Propulsion Theory and Engineering, International Business and Chinese Culture. These students, with their diverse cultural backgrounds, contribute to the broad international focus of the university.
Scholarship
In order to drive enthusiasm and study initiative, encourage and support excellence in conduct and academy, create a good study atmosphere and drive diligent study, Shenyang Aerospace University hereby formulates this Outstanding/distinguished International Student's Scholarship Procedures.
1. Conditions for Application
I. Applicants shall be normal self-sponsored international students; registered for an undergraduate or postgraduate program for one (1) year or above and haven’t applied for temporary leave or extension of study;
II. Applicants shall observe and abide by every law of China, school rules and regulations, and not have any record of violation;
III. Applicants shall respect the authority, love the school, respect other foreign students, be friendly and positively participate in school organized activities;
IV. Applicants shall possess honest code of honor, be excellent in quality and have comprehensively good behavior synthesis evaluation;
V. Applicants shall be upright in study, diligent and have an outstanding academic record for the previous semester.
(a)First Prize Scholarship applicants shall have a minimum average of 85% with scores from each course not less than 80 marks;
(b) Second Prize Scholarship applicants shall have a minimum average of 80% with scores from each course not less than 75 marks;
(c) Third Prize Scholarship applicants shall have a minimum of 70 marks in every course.
(d) Single Item Scholarship applicants shall have a minimum of 65 marks in all courses.
2. Award Establishment
The University sets apart 5% of the total international students’ fee every year for the Outstanding International Students’ Scholarship.
(a) First Prize, RMB300 per month, awarded to 5% of the total number of students;
(b) Second Prize, RMB200 per month, awarded to 10% of the total number of students;
(c) Third Prize, RMB150 per month, awarded to 40% of the total number of students.
Single Item Scholarship :
(i) Outstanding Class Cadre Prize, RMB100 per month
(ii) Progressive Study Prize, RMB100 per month
(iii) Technological Activity Prize, RMB100 per month
(iv) Outstanding Literature Prize, RMB100 per month
(v) Outstanding Social Activity Prize, RMB50 per month
(vi) Full Attendance Award, RMB50 per month
The comprehensive scholarship prize and the single item scholarship may be awarded concurrently.
3. Evaluation procedures
The university establishes an International Students’ Scholarship Appraisal Committee. The committee is to be composed of the related school leaderships and the secondary units in charge; the international student office is responsible for the concrete details.
At the beginning of each semester, international students who meet the conditions for the scholarship should submit written application to the international students’ office
Based on the international student’s application, academic record and daily behavior performance (academic record 75%, daily behavior performance 25%), initial comments shall be made by the international students’ office organization, initial comments shall include class and grade evaluation, teacher evaluation and other procedures.
The international students’ office will compose the names of the applicants meeting the necessary condition, then report to the international students’ scholarship appraisal committee for consideration in the scheduled time then finally determine the scholarship students’ name list.
The Scholarship evaluation result shall be published on the international students’ office website.
4. Scholarship distribution procedure
The scholarship adopts a monthly distribution method; the international students’ office shall go through the distribution procedure before the 15th of every month.

Applicant Qualifications
All applicants must be in good health.
(1) Bachelor's Degree: Under the age of 35, a high school graduate or with equivalent qualification of 12-year education background. Passing the 4th level HSK is required if study in Chinese language. Mathematics, physics and chemistry with 60% of total marks results are necessary for engineering degree courses.
(2) Master's Degree: Under the age of 45, a bachelor degree or equivalent qualification. Passing the 6th level HSK is required if study in Chinese language. Mathematics, physics and chemistry with 60% of total marks results are necessary for engineering degree courses.
(3) Junior Advanced Study: Under the age of 35, a B.S. degree or equivalent qualification, able to take courses in English or in Chinese.
(4) Senior Advanced Study: Under the age of 45, a B.S. degree, M.S. degree or equivalent qualification, able to take courses in English or in Chinese.
(5) Chinese Language Course: No prerequisite required.
